About KraneShares Hang Seng TECH Index ETF

KTEC tracks the Hang Seng TECH Index, providing targeted exposure to the 30 largest technology companies listed on the Hong Kong Stock Exchange. It focuses on innovative, internet-based businesses across sectors like e-commerce, fintech, cloud computing, and digital technology.

About Vistra Corp

Vistra is a leading integrated retail electricity and power generation company that serves as a critical infrastructure provider for the digital economy. It operates a diversified portfolio of zero-carbon nuclear and renewable assets alongside a massive, flexible natural gas fleet, positioning it as an indispensable partner for energy-intensive AI data centers and industrial electrification.
